Dutse has a hot semi-arid to tropical savanna climate, classified most commonly as Köppen Aw, with a long dry season and a shorter wet season concentrated in mid-year. Long-term climate data show very hot pre-monsoon months, a wetter and more humid July–September period, and relatively dry, sunny conditions for much of the year. Spring
March - May
29-38°C
Spring is the hottest part of the year in Dutse, with intense daytime heat and very dry air before the rains begin. Dust and clear skies are common early in the season, followed by increasing cloud cover toward May.
Low rainfall
Summer
June - August
26-33°C
Summer is the wet season, with more clouds, higher humidity, and frequent rainfall. Temperatures remain warm, but conditions feel less harsh than in late spring because of the rain and cloud cover.
High rainfall
Autumn
September - November
25-34°C
Autumn is the transition back to dry weather, starting with some residual rain in September and then becoming progressively sunnier. By November, conditions are typically hot, dry, and very bright.
Moderate rainfall
Winter
December - February
20-33°C
Winter is the coolest and driest season, with warm days and much cooler nights, especially in January. Skies are often clear and humidity is lower than during the rainy season.
Very Low rainfall
